Obituary

Beverly Hodges at 73 years old finished her life and began dancing with Jesus on July 22, 2021. Nicknamed by her father, Butch was born in Mobile Alabama in 1948 to Paul and Frances Swaney.  She moved to Fayetteville, North Carolina as a young girl and grew up with her older sister Pat and younger siblings brother Paul Jr. and sister Teresa. 

 

Butch graduated from Seventy First High School in 1968 and attended Fayetteville Beauty Academy where she obtained her cosmetologist license.  Butch styled hair for 45 years owning her own salon and providing services to those living at Hope Mills Retirement Center. The ladies would line up every Thursday morning clambering for the first spot in her chair.

 

Butch and James met in high school at 16 and 17 years old, when he would drive her school bus. They were married 54 years and together 58. In her younger years, she enjoyed caring for their horses and raising dogs.  Butch loved romance novels, bingo, the beach, and going out to eat with other couples. She relished finding collectibles and shopping for clothing. James would say she was part owner of QVC shopping network.  Together her and James enjoyed cruising; one of her favorite vacations was going to Hawaii and sailing to the islands. Butch and James raised two boys Brandon and Aaron.  They have three grandchildren Jenna, Wyatt, and Elaina.
